Discussion and findings during regulatory review of Program Administrators' 2013-2015 Three-Year Plans 13 In the 2013- 2015 Order approving the Program Administrators' 2013-2015 Three-Year Plans, the Department stated that non-energy impac...
AI summary The Department of Public Utilities reviewed Program Administrators' 2013-2015 Three-Year Plans, focusing on non-energy impacts in cost-effectiveness analyses. The Attorney General argued for reevaluating the TRC test's reliance on non-energy benefits, questioning their reliability, uniformity, and whether they accrue to participants. The Department considered excluding three non-energy impacts (National Security, Refrigerator/Freezer Turn-In, Economic Development) due to societal vs. participant benefit distinctions.

Table 3: Property Value Adjustment Median Single-Family House Price Multiplier Nova Scotia 23 $229,000 44% Massachusetts 24 $516,600 44 70 Other NEB categories were also identified as having values that varied based on location. To accurat...
AI summary Table 3 outlines property value adjustments with median house prices and multipliers for Nova Scotia and Massachusetts. The document discusses the removal of health impact values from Non-Energy Benefits (NEB) in Massachusetts due to differences in how societal benefits are accounted for in Canada, impacting the Residential NEB adaptation.
Other specific NEBs identified and valued in the analysis of residential measures include thermal comfort, noise reduction, and home durability. We made the assumption that noise reduction and home durability in Nova Scotia and Massachuset...
AI summary The analysis identifies non-energy benefits (NEBs) such as thermal comfort, noise reduction, and home durability from residential energy efficiency measures. A comparison of heating and cooling degree days between Nova Scotia and Massachusetts showed a 2.2% difference, with Nova Scotia requiring more heating, but no adjustment was made to thermal comfort values due to the small discrepancy.
